Nikolai Fuchs, born 1963, grew up in the Ruhr area, graduated from an agricultural education in Lübeck and studied agricultural sciences with emphasis on conservation in Bonn. After conducting activities in the nature center Eifel he spent seven years as a consultant and manager in the Demeter Association on State and federal level work. From 2001 to 2010 he headed the Agricultural Section at the Goetheanum in Switzerland and, in parallel, the Office of Demeter International in Brussels. Since 2010 he is responsible for the Nexus Foundation in Geneva. He is also advisory organizations and scientific foundations. His travels, mainly in Europe but also in all other parts of the world have sharpened his eye for the environment and social relations.
